Authenticity Versus Algorithms
Greg Williams joins the podcast this week to share his experience and perspective after working more than twenty years in the outdoor industry. Now President of Backbone Media, he's been able to see the growth of the industry, as well as support the careers of many of the people in it - both current employees as well as those who got their start at Backbone. With the long view of the highs and lows of the industry, Greg has plenty to share in this discussion, both where we've been - and what the future may hold.

BPC - Brand, Product, Content
BPC is our closing segment where we share new brands that we’ve discovered, products we’re using, or content that we love.
💪 Rucking - 5.11: Greg and his team are getting into rucking as a bonding (and fitness) activity, the 5.11 weighted vest has been their go-to setup for the company rucking missions.
🚀 Hyperwear Weighted Vest: This is the vest that Aaron bought his wife for their 13th wedding anniversary. True love!
🏆 Hard MTB League: Braydon Bringhurst is creating something incredibly new and refreshing for the world of mountain biking. After launching a test event about a year ago, the league finally has proper support and is moving ahead.
📈 The Knowledge Podcast - Ryan Petersen: Ryan Petersen has created an incredible logistics/shipping company that has disrupted incumbents who have held control for decades. Shane Parrish’s podcast digs into the story behind the brand.
